Seite 2 von 3

Re: Trigger bei Eingängen? Und openHAB.

Verfasst: Sonntag 1. Februar 2015, 09:57
von paphko
Hallo Klaus,

könntest du vielleicht noch ein ein Issue bei openHAB einstellen? -> https://github.com/openhab/openhab/issues
Dann kann es dort offiziell diskutiert und nach dem Fix auch in den Release Notes dokumentiert werden ;)

Re: Trigger bei Eingängen? Und openHAB.

Verfasst: Sonntag 1. Februar 2015, 13:25
von Klaus

Re: Trigger bei Eingängen? Und openHAB.

Verfasst: Montag 2. Februar 2015, 11:42
von paphko
Ich habe das lokal mal auf die Schnelle versucht zu korrigieren, probier doch mal bitte dieses jar aus: https://www.dropbox.com/s/gwwr7vl7z3b2f ... 7.jar?dl=0
Einfach im addons-Verzeichnis das jar ersetzen.

Re: Trigger bei Eingängen? Und openHAB.

Verfasst: Montag 2. Februar 2015, 13:27
von Klaus
Danke, aber das scheint noch nicht zu passen:

13:22:27.257 [DEBUG] [a.internal.AnelConnectorThread:201 ] - Sending to 192.168.15.9: wer da?
13:22:27.272 [DEBUG] [a.internal.AnelConnectorThread:240 ] - Clearing cache because it was older than 0 minutes.
13:22:27.272 [ERROR] [a.internal.AnelConnectorThread:267 ] - Error occured when received data from Anel device: 192.168.15.9
java.lang.ArrayIndexOutOfBoundsException: 16
at org.openhab.binding.anel.internal.AnelDataParser.parseData(AnelDataParser.java:104) ~[na:na]
at org.openhab.binding.anel.internal.AnelConnectorThread.run(AnelConnectorThread.java:244) ~[na:na]

Re: Trigger bei Eingängen? Und openHAB.

Verfasst: Montag 2. Februar 2015, 15:11
von paphko
Klaus hat geschrieben:Danke, aber das scheint noch nicht zu passen:
Stimmt, ich hatte den Index falsch abgefragt. Neuer Versuch: https://www.dropbox.com/s/oqcb3i31uomv3 ... 0.jar?dl=0

Re: Trigger bei Eingängen? Und openHAB.

Verfasst: Montag 2. Februar 2015, 16:46
von Klaus
Zunächst nochmal DANKE für den schnellen Support. Da hätte ich mich jetzt mit einer neuen Programmiersprache etwas schwer getan...

Die Stati bekomme ich jetzt richtig angezeigt. Wenn ich probiere zu schalten, dann "springt" der Schalter aber gleich wieder in den alten Zustand zurück...
Ist es normal, dass im Log so ein "Datensalat" drinsteht?

16:26:00.369 [DEBUG] [a.internal.AnelConnectorThread:201 ] - Sending to 192.168.15.9: wer da?
16:26:00.383 [DEBUG] [a.internal.AnelConnectorThread:240 ] - Clearing cache because it was older than 0 minutes.
16:26:00.384 [DEBUG] [a.internal.AnelConnectorThread:249 ] - newValues (len=25): {F8=OFF, F2=ON, F7NAME=Nr. 7, F8NAME=Nr. 8, F1NAME=IP-Cam, F1LOCKED=OFF, F6LOCKED=ON, F7LOCKED=ON, F8LOCKED=ON, F1=OFF, F3NAME=Synology DS, F4=OFF, F6=OFF, F2NAME=HomeMatic CCU, NAME=NETPWRCTRL , F4NAME=Nr. 4, F3=ON, F5=OFF, F7=OFF, F2LOCKED=OFF, F5NAME=Nr. 5, F3LOCKED=OFF, F4LOCKED=ON, F6NAME=Nr. 6, F5LOCKED=ON}


Ich hätte eigentlich erwartet, dass die Daten geordnet von F1 nach F8 zurück kämen ...

Re: Trigger bei Eingängen? Und openHAB.

Verfasst: Montag 2. Februar 2015, 16:58
von paphko
Klaus hat geschrieben:Ich hätte eigentlich erwartet, dass die Daten geordnet von F1 nach F8 zurück kämen ...
Naja, ich verarbeite die Updates in einer unsortierten Map, aber das geht natürlich auch sortiert: https://www.dropbox.com/s/ci5swo65lm2bn ... 5.jar?dl=0

Hast du mal autoupdate="false" beim Item ausprobiert?

Re: Trigger bei Eingängen? Und openHAB.

Verfasst: Montag 2. Februar 2015, 17:56
von Klaus
Jetzt habe ich auch nochmal autoupdate="false" probiert, leider ohne Erfolg.

Schalte ich extern um, dann wird der angezeigte Zustand (ON/OFF) im Web-Interface sauber nachgezogen.
Versuche ich im openHAB Web-Interface umzuschalten, dann erzeuge ich zwar einen Eintrag im Events.log, z.B.
2015-02-02 17:45:34 - Anel1 received command ON
es passiert aber nichts ...

Im openhab.log kann ich dazu aber nichts finden... Müsste da auch was stehen?

Re: Trigger bei Eingängen? Und openHAB.

Verfasst: Dienstag 3. Februar 2015, 10:07
von paphko
Stimmt, das Schaltverhalten ist nicht ganz wie erwartet.
Ich bin gerade selbst am umbauen, sodass ich das erst die Tage richtig testen und debuggen kann.

Re: Trigger bei Eingängen? Und openHAB.

Verfasst: Dienstag 3. Februar 2015, 23:46
von paphko
paphko hat geschrieben:Stimmt, das Schaltverhalten ist nicht ganz wie erwartet.
I don't get it... wenn ich openhab auf einem RasPi (Wheezy) laufen lasse, funktioniert das Schalten nicht. Sobald exakt das selbe (!) openhab unter Windows läuft, funzt alles wie erwartet :shock:
Hast du das mal unter Windows getestet?